Gutierrez, “Eleventh place in Spain was like a victory”

He didn't score any points, but at least he didn't do any damage. Esteban Gutierrez he left Barcelona with an eleventh place, nothing exciting, but enough to make him rejoice and to make the team breathe a sigh of relief Clean.

“It was a really special weekend for me, which gave me an important result after four races that didn't go exactly as I would have liked – the Mexican confided to Autosport – Even if I didn't get into the top ten, for me it's as if I had won. It was definitely a big step forward as far as I'm concerned and I thank the team for giving me all the time and tools to get there."

“We couldn't have asked much more of him – confided the chief designer Matt morris – He set some good times and was even in the lead for a while, which I think did him a lot of good. We never had any doubts about his pace, he has already shown that he is fast, but only in racing do you build up a wealth of experience. In the first races he put himself under a lot of pressure and we made some mistakes, while on this occasion he performed very well all weekend, so we are very happy with him."
